Safety measures and compliance requirements particular to containers will likely turn out to be more refined as adoption grows. Containers have a lifecycle that features creation, operating, stopping, and deletion. Container orchestration platforms handle the container lifecycle, making certain that containers are provisioned, scaled, and terminated as needed. Container lifecycle management also includes features like rolling updates, which permit for gradually replacing containers with newer versions to reduce downtime and ensure a smooth transition. CaaS encourages the adoption of microservices architecture, where applications are broken down into impartial elements referred to as microservices. Every microservice performs a particular perform and communicates with other microservices via well-defined APIs.
What Are Some Great Benefits Of Containers As A Service?
To implement CaaS in your data science workflows, you’ll need to determine on a CaaS provider and comply with best practices for deployment and management. In this article, we are going to explore the various advantages of CaaS for information science initiatives and delve into finest practices for implementing CaaS in your workflows. One of the most sought after service for enterprises is Container-as-a-Service (CaaS).
Containers are light and quick to work with, and therefore it’s easy to create containers and destroy them. Sometimes if the program that is being run throughout the container occurs to run into an infinite concern, the container can simply be killed. This ensures that the whole hardware is not affected and sources aren’t consumed regularly owing to the difficulty.
What Is Container?
CaaS permits customers to construct safe, scalable containerized applications in either on-premises or cloud data centres. This structure uses containers and clusters as a service, which may be deployed in the cloud or on-premises data centres. CaaS is a cloud-based service hosted by a third-party provider that helps manage and deploy containerized applications. Kubernetes is an open-source platform for Linux container orchestration, initially What Is Crypto as a Service developed by engineers at Google.
Containers as a service (CaaS) are cloud-based services that assist make the administration and deployment of container-based functions even simpler. The utilization of containers has seen a significant improve in efficiency and provides the flexibility to deploy purposes shortly and ease creating micro-services-based functions. Containerization helps us to release the applications quicker and is portable as we will use it in both on-premise and multi-cloud environments and helps to cut back infrastructure and working costs.
Simply as CaaS is specific to container deployments, capabilities as a service (FaaS) are particular to microservices deployments where customers must run specific utility components with out managing servers. A subset of serverless infrastructure, FaaS focuses on event-driven computing models the place application code, or containers, run in response to a particular occasion or request. Containers-as-a-Service (CaaS) is a cloud service that uses container-based virtualization to addContent, organize, run, scale and handle containers. CaaS continues to grow in importance https://www.xcritical.com/ because of the rise of technologies like container expertise, microservices-based architecture and cloud computing. Container as a Service (CaaS) is a cloud computing model where a supplier manages the infrastructure and platform required to run containerized purposes. Implementing containers as a service for data science can present many advantages, including increased portability, scalability, and cost-effectiveness.
Rather than requiring an operating system per occasion, containers share the working occasion of the working system internet hosting them. OS-level options provide isolation between containers in order that one container cannot have an result on different working containers. Each container in CaaS can have its personal working system and language stack with the principle objective being to make sure consistent habits across person environments. IaaS permits developers to request entry to a cloud computing occasion via their internet hosting supplier. With distant access and configuration, customized software program could be installed.
What Is Caas And How Does It Work?
A software program growth group may use CaaS to automate the deployment and administration of their applications. For instance, builders can use CaaS to deploy their applications to a staging setting for testing, and then promote them to production when they’re ready. This can help streamline the event and deployment process and cut back the chance of errors. CaaS can be utilized to deploy data-intensive functions, corresponding to knowledge analytics platforms or machine learning models. By packaging these purposes in containers, organizations can guarantee constant performance and scalability across different environments. Many fashionable web purposes are built utilizing containers and deployed on CaaS platforms.
The subsequent step could be to survey the market, researching the available choices to see those that match the needs of your mannequin. To learn more, you probably can take a glance at this post on the advantages of containers. Since the unit of virtualization was the entire machine, starting it involved starting a (virtual) computer! In addition, the inefficient use of storage remained an unsolved problem. There was no way to get a quantity of VMs to share a single working system installation. Hardware advances had been able to velocity up the processing VMs needed, however some issues remained.
- The reference supplies shall be revealed in July and submitted to the United Nations’ International Civil Aviation Organisation in September.
- Containers as a Service is a subscription-based service mannequin that permits us to handle, ship and run the containers and applications wherever.
- CaaS additionally has distinctive integration capabilities that help businesses optimize their IT infrastructure.
- This is due to the character of data being processed by the appliance occasion.
The provisioning of CaaS resources is completed in a number of steps and the process takes seconds to run or deploy the purposes. Containers create constant environments to rapidly develop and ship cloud-native functions that can run anyplace. Many organizations play an ongoing guessing recreation whereby they repeatedly must forecast the services they need, only to be taught later that the company really needed kind of than what was provisioned. CaaS can help firms stop overprovisioning companies, helping guarantee they get precisely what they need.
It is the provision Stockbroker of Containers by Cloud service providers, to enterprises, at a reasonable charge. Containers are the digital spaces during which developers can code and execute packages similar to digital machines. The distinction here is the non-dependency of containers on the bottom operating system. This allows developers and testers to successfully work on the code with out the assorted points brought on as a end result of varying working techniques. Cloud services provide containers to enterprises on their Cloud infrastructure as a service, hence CaaS.